Sun in Svelvik, Norway

All you need to know about the sun in Svelvik, Norway.

The Sun rises at 09:12 and sets at 15:16. These times are essential for planning outdoor activities, photography, or just enjoying nature.

The golden hour is the period of soft, warm light perfect for photography and occurs shortly after sunrise and just before sunset. In Svelvik, the golden hour starts at 08:36 and ends at 11:06 in the morning and then again at 13:22 in the evening, ending at 15:52.

Civil twilight is the first and last phase of twilight. In the morning, civil dawn begins at 08:16, marking the time when there's enough light for most outdoor activities. In the evening, civil dusk happens at 16:12, right after sunset at 15:16.

Nautical twilight is the period when the Sun is 6-12 degrees below the horizon, commonly used by sailors to navigate at sea. In Svelvik, nautical dawn starts at 07:20 and nautical dusk occurs at 17:08.

Astronomical twilight occurs when the Sun is 12-18 degrees below the horizon, and the sky is dark enough for astronomers to observe faint celestial objects. Astronomical dawn in Svelvik starts at 06:29, while astronomical dusk ends at 17:59.
